When exploring the alternatives readily available for securing your home, it becomes clear that a reactive approach is seldom successful. Spraying noticeable pests with over-the-counter chemicals may provide a short-term sense of relief, but it stops working to deal with the heart of the problem. The true colony lives deep underground or within concealed structural voids. Professional interventions concentrate on outright eradication and long term exemption. Modern methods typically involve a combination of comprehensive subfloor assessments, specialized soil barriers, and advanced monitoring systems customized particularly to the local soil types and structure designs found throughout the city.

Among the most dependable approaches made use of by local professionals involves the creation of a constant chemical more info soil zone around the boundary of the building foundation. Professionals apply specialized, non repellent liquid deterrents to the earth surrounding the footings. Since the insects can not spot the presence of the compound, they travel through it easily and unwittingly move the active ingredients back to the central nesting site. This procedure triggers a domino effect that ultimately gets rid of the entire population, including the queen. For residential or commercial properties built on concrete slabs or those with intricate extensions, service technicians might utilize exact concrete drilling techniques to guarantee the protective barrier remains entirely unbroken.

Professionals position these low‑profile stations discreetly in the soil near the structure's exterior walls. Packed with extremely appealing wood or cellulose bait, the stations tempt foraging workers before they go into the structure. When activity is observed, professionals apply a targeted growth‑regulator bait. The workers consume the bait and share it throughout the nest, interrupting molting and ultimately wiping out the entire colony. This method needs constant, diligent tracking by a certified specialist to keep the system practical and reliable.

In New South Wales, building inspections are a standard component of the property buying process. A history of unaddressed pest activity or the lack of a validated management system can substantially reduce a property evaluation or perhaps trigger a potential sale to collapse completely. Conversely, keeping an existing certificate of compliance and a documented history of expert inspections supplies tremendous confidence to future buyers, showcasing that the structure has actually been carefully looked after throughout the years.
